Preamble:
https://www.eclipse.org/lists/jakartaee-platform-dev/msg01180.html
Please vote +1/0/-1 on the following. Any non +1 vote, please provide
reasoning in your reply. Thank you!
Required (leave in javax namespace) - Vote
• Jakarta Activation 1.2
Jakarta Activation was one of the APIs dropped from Java SE 11 per JEP
320. Several Jakarta EE technologies require the use of Jakarta Activation,
so we can't make it optional. It is required for Jakarta EE. This
vote is for whether we move this feature to the jakarta namespace (-1)
or leave it in the javax namespace (+1). The recommendation is to
Jakarta Activation in the javax namespace. And, if at some later
date, this API needs to evolve and move to the jakarta namespace, then
we can deal with the ripple effect on other specs at that time.
Note: A -1 vote indicates that you want Jakarta Activation to
be migrated to the jakarta namespace. And, if we do that, then there
is a ripple effect that will also require corresponding changes to jaxb,
jax-ws, and soap. Thus, a -1 vote here means that Vote 3 on the other
Optional specs won't apply. That is, voting -1 here and +1 on Vote
3 doesn't make any sense. Check out this tool from Tomitribe: https://www.tomitribe.com/jakarta/ns/poll/vote
Note2: This assumes that all of the existing Specification PRs
for these technologies are properly brought under the EE4J umbrella. We
discussed these at the Spec Committee call today and we are well aware
that we need to move on these and get them approved.
